What the data says

Of the 150 pupils who finished Year 11 at Sidmouth College in 2023, 32% stayed on in Sidmouth College’s own sixth form (Devon average 23%), 47% went to a further education college and 6% started an apprenticeship.

Among the 72 students who left the sixth form in 2023, 33% went to university (Devon 25%, England 37%), and 27% of level 3 students progressed to one of the most selective universities, against 19% nationally.

Photography is unusually popular at GCSE: 21% of the year group took it, against 6% of pupils across England.

A level grades average C, well below the England average of B-; 6% of students achieved AAB or better including two facilitating subjects (England 18%). The largest A level subjects are Geography, Business Studies and Psychology.

Progress 8 is not available for 2025 and 2026: these cohorts had no Key Stage 2 tests in 2020 and 2021, so there is no baseline. Attainment 8 shows results without taking pupils’ starting points into account.
